Transaction ba31dc6143a4e323eca3baef266dcac27a689eb383ecd681de361d68aaccf802
1 Input
1 Output
-
ba31dc6143a4e323eca3baef266dcac27a689eb383ecd681de361d68aaccf802:0
- value
- 373445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f05055e7daabb60c87ca92212d659d17ed1918a OP_EQUAL
- address
- 35ydhRVb96YzeA4bXh3qhiahyv4RW5aUr1